Olivia C

5.0

Reviewed a 2011 Toyota Sequoia on Aug 23, 2025

This is my 4th Toyota suv. I’ve had a ‘00 4runner, ‘07 RAV4, and a 2016 4runner. My first time experiencing the Sequoia Limited’s v8 and have absolutely loved it. This is our dream family car. The space is incredible, the power, and durability of Toyotas never cease to amaze me. It’s perfect for mountain life daily ascents and descents. Has the best turn radius of any full sized suv I’ve driven - making it super friendly for switchback roads and city outings as well. I know this will be the adventure-forward family hauler we were looking for. We bought high mileage (> 200k) with zero hesitation since we know Toyotas well and this beast will get us at least 10 years of drivability. You know when you buy a Toyota you’re not getting the most luxe experience from a creature comforts perceptive. It’s important to note that a vehicle that starts no matter what is more important to us than having Bluetooth etc. but the experience still feels luxurious with many adapters on the market these days.
